Popular places to visit
Parliament House
4.5/5(17 reviews)
Admire the scale, architecture and artwork of the building where Australia’s politicians make the big decisions.
Australian War Memorial
5/5(14 reviews)
Wander the halls of this monument to learn about the battles fought by Australians, see military hardware and admire artworks.
National Museum of Australia
4/5(5 reviews)
Explore the vast collection of Aboriginal art and artefacts, learn about the country’s colonial past, and see maps, vehicles, weapons and jewellery.
